Copier Leasing questions for Sacramento, CA
What are the lease terms available for Sacramento businesses?+
We offer lease terms from 24 to 60 months through our North Shore Leasing partnership. Most Sacramento businesses choose 36 or 48-month terms, which balance monthly payment level against the risk of the equipment becoming outdated. Shorter terms mean higher monthly payments but more flexibility to upgrade. Longer terms lower the monthly payment but mean you are on the same equipment longer. We walk through the tradeoffs with you before you sign anything. Fair market value leases and dollar buyout leases are both available depending on whether you want the option to purchase the equipment at end of term.
Is copier leasing better than buying for a Sacramento business?+
It depends on your cash flow, tax situation, and growth trajectory. Leasing conserves capital - you preserve your credit lines and cash for operations, inventory, or hiring rather than locking them into a depreciating piece of equipment. Lease payments may be fully deductible as a business expense, while purchased equipment is depreciated over time. Leasing also makes it easier to upgrade: when technology improves or your volume outgrows your current device, you restructure the lease rather than trying to sell used equipment. The main advantage of buying is lower total cost if you plan to use the equipment for a very long time. What happens at the end of a copier lease in Sacramento?+
At the end of your lease term, you have several options. You can return the equipment and lease a new model - the most common choice, since it gets you current technology. You can purchase the equipment at fair market value if you are on a fair market value lease, or for one dollar if you chose a dollar buyout structure. You can also extend the lease on a month-to-month basis if you are not ready to make a decision.
